    My mom is also a quilter, one who loves to work with scraps and do hand embroidery. She has never used a computer in her life and so is not on the board. But I want to show off some of her work. I read a lot of the posts here to her and show her the pictures. I think she will enjoy having some of her work shown.

    In the first she fussy cut a big butterfly from fabric and fused it to a background. Then she did crazy quilt border, and then she embroidered the details and did the flowers. I love this one and am still trying to talk her out of it. It would be beautiful on my wall. The second in a mini crazy quilt about 12 in. square she made last week and it is hanging on her wall.
